AsiaSat 9 fully operational at 122°E
Nov 27, 2017 – AsiaSat 9 is fully operational at 122°E following successful migration of all services from AsiaSat 4, delivering enhanced power, greater bandwidth and improved efficiency to customers for advanced DTH, TV distribution, VSAT broadband and mobility services across the Asia-Pacific.

2.8 million SVOD subscribers in SAARC countries in Q2 2017
Oct 13, 2017 – According to Dataxis, in the second quarter of 2017, SVOD subscribers in SAARC countries reached 2.8 million at a quarter on quarter rate of 89%, compared to 1.5 million in the second quarter of 2016. India is by far the biggest SVOD market.

SAARC pay TV market value will double by 2021
Apr 12, 2017 – According to Dataxis, the major SAARC countries (India, Bangladesh, Pakistan, Nepal, Sri Lanka) plus Myanmar will see their pay TV market doubled by 2021, to reach US$ 16 billion compared to just US$ 8 billion in 2016.

Myanmar TV market continues to grow exponentially
Dec 5, 2016 – CASBAA has released a members-only report on the multichannel market in Myanmar. Within the traditional TV market there are signs of rapid expansion and multichannel TV investment continues apace.

NEC Provides Commercial Broadcaster in Myanmar with DTT Transmitters
Oct 3, 2012 – NEC (NEC; TSE: 6701) is providing Myanmar's new commercial broadcaster, Myanmar Album Media Services (MAMS), with digital TV broadcasting transmitters through one of the country's system integrators, RedLink Communications.

Myanmar to launch Sky Net DTH and MPS systems in November
Oct 7, 2010 – Myanmar plans to launch Sky Net DTH (Direct to Home) and Sky Net MPS (Multiplay Service) in the first week of November. The service will be provided by Myanmar Radio and Television and the PTT Ministry in cooperation with local companies.

ASEAN reaches agreement on specifications for Set-top Boxes and Analogue Broadcasting Switch-off
Jun 19, 2008 – The 6th ASEAN Digital Broadcasting (ADB) Meeting in Singapore successfully concluded with officials agreeing on a common set of technical specifications for Standard Definition and High Definition digital set-top-boxes for ASEAN.
